Sihori Population - Mahamaya Nagar, Uttar Pradesh

Sihori is a large village located in Sikandra Rao Tehsil of Mahamaya Nagar district, Uttar Pradesh with total 495 families residing. The Sihori village has population of 3010 of which 1591 are males while 1419 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Sihori village population of children with age 0-6 is 548 which makes up 18.21 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Sihori village is 892 which is lower than Uttar Pradesh state average of 912. Child Sex Ratio for the Sihori as per census is 909, higher than Uttar Pradesh average of 902.

Sihori village has higher literacy rate compared to Uttar Pradesh. In 2011, literacy rate of Sihori village was 68.60 % compared to 67.68 % of Uttar Pradesh. In Sihori Male literacy stands at 81.21 % while female literacy rate was 54.40 %.

Caste Factor

Sihori village of Mahamaya Nagar has substantial population of Schedule Caste.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 29.14 % of total population in Sihori village. The village Sihori currently doesn’t have any Schedule Tribe (ST) population.

Work Profile

In Sihori village out of total population, 772 were engaged in work activities. 58.16 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 41.84 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 772 workers engaged in Main Work, 149 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 158 were Agricultural labourer.
